Packing Products Co. v. United States
29 Cust. Ct. 356, 1952 Cust. Ct. LEXIS 1494
United States Customs Court·Decided July 25, 1952·No. No. 56814; protest 179934-K (New York)·Published
Opinion
Opinion by
The court finding that the protest was not filed within the statutory period of 60 days after liquidation, as required by section 514, Tariff Act of 1930, the motion to dismiss was granted.
